In Vogue’s interview series “Off the Cuff,” in which costars interview each other, Kidman, 57, told her A Family Affair co-star Joey King that there is a certain costume she wore in 2001’s Moulin Rouge that she still wishes she had kept.
“I wish I kept the pink feathers from Moulin Rouge, ’cause they’re so beautiful,” the actress said of one of the ensembles she donned as nightclub singer Satine in the film.
During one of Satine’s performances, Kidman wore a two-piece ensemble that included a fitted embroidered bustier and a pink feathered train. Catherine Martin and Angus Strathie, the film’s co-costume designers, selected it.
The Practical Magic actor told King, 24, that she regretted not preserving the glasses her character Alice Harford wore in the 1999 film Eyes Wide Shut, in which she costarred with her ex-husband Tom Cruise.
“I keep nothing,” Kidman acknowledged, adding, “But I do keep all of my couture dresses.”
